FIDELITY Trade Names by: Anonymous
Hi Clair thank you for writing in with the following hallmark question:
"hi i own a antique bangle by h g & sons and it is hallmarked and states fidelity please can you tell me what fidelity means on the bangle many thanks claire"
Claire the only thing I could find - FIDELITY was the trading name used by K. Polishook & Sons Corp (rings)
It was also the trading name used by Silvermann, Kohen & Wallenstien Inc. (diamond rings)
